About this Item
First edition, first printing. Bound in publisher's original brick-red cloth with printed title label to spine. About Near Fine with lean and light sunning to spine, edge wear and toning to title label on spine. Front inner hinge slightly exposed, former owner name on front free endpaper and pages toned. A lovely copy of this scarce feminist work, in which Stetson speaks of an uneven power distribution between men and women, that men have claimed credit for human progress and that most female activities are directed by men, and she calls on women to change their cultural identities.
